I was born in East Java, Indonesia. My father was an active Navy at that time and my mother was just a house wife. When I was 3 years and 2 months old, and my brother was 7 months old, my mother passed away, so both of us, I and my brother never knew how she looked like. We just saw her face from her photogrpahs.
My father was very busy with his duties in navy, so my grandmother from my mother side took care of us. She was very kind person and very good in cooking. She had inspired me. I wanted to be like her who could cook well for my family. It becomes reality now. My family really enjoy the food that I always cook.
After around 2 years of my mother's passed away, my father married again to a beautiful young woman. Because she was too young and my father often left us (because of his duties), she cheated with other man and she also could not handle how took care of us properly. From those reasons, my father made a decision to divorce her. Their marriage was not longer than 1.5 year. Finally my grandmother took care of us back again. She loved us so much.
After around 4-5 years, my father married again to another woman who had given us very hard time. Although she was not a mother who we wished and neither an ideal wife, but my father, I and my brother gave the respect to her. From this marriage, I and my brother have 2 sisters. Because of how superior and dominan she was, I and my brother didn't have close relationship with her and both of my sisters. She also changed my father caracters but he still loved us.
Although my father had done a big mistake in marrying her, we never complained. We as christians believe that our life are in GOD hand. If He has given her to us as a part of our family, we believe God has great plans in our life, and it is. One thing that we can learn from our father is about the decipline and hard work to reach our goals. He has inspired me to be a perfect person although I know there is no perfect person in the world, but at least he has taught me a very valuable things that I needed to do in my life to be a very good person. I thanked to God for giving him to be my father in my life. As there is no perfect person, it means there is no perfect father too.
Through many years of the difficult times, I and my brother became so close each other. When I felt sad and needed someone to listen my sharing, I just went to him and I could talked to him in many hours. He was a great blessing my life.
